Microfiber Polishing Pads?

Does anyone use microfiber polishing pads with their DA polisher? I've used foam pads for years but it's time to get some new ones and I thought I'd try them out. Any brand recommendations or other tips?

Quote:
Originally Posted by Ian///M
Can't see MF being able to polish or cut like foam does. I would see MF more for use as an applicator.
Quite the contrary now. Mf cutting discs have more cut than foam pads. I was going to get either optimum or uber mf cutting discs but I decided to wait till spring when I stock up for the year.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Ian///M View Post
Can't see MF being able to polish or cut like foam does. I would see MF more for use as an applicator.
Meguiars have really perfected their system and it is the product to get right now.

For DA polishers MF pads offer less weight, which means more rotation, which leads to more correction.


Have I used any? Nope. I'm still using LCC Hydropads on my Makita, but will eventually pick some up.
